Summary - Brazil Agriculture Tour to the Coopavel Show Rural

Coopavel Show Rural in Cascavel

Experience Brazil’s agricultural heartland on a journey built around the Coopavel Show Rural, one of the country’s most important agricultural events. Begin at Iguassu Falls, then continue into Paraná, a state known for fertile farmland, soybean production, cooperatives, and innovative agribusiness.

During the tour, visit the Coopavel Show Rural in Cascavel, explore soybean fields in Paraná, learn how agricultural products move through Brazil’s logistics network, and spend a night on a working farm near one of the country’s major soybean regions. Along the way, you’ll see how modern farming, rural communities, and Brazil’s natural landscapes connect.

After the agricultural portion of the trip, continue through southern Brazil and the Atlantic Rainforest, including a scenic railway journey toward Curitiba. Finish with guided sightseeing in São Paulo and Rio de Janeiro, including a Rio de Janeiro city tour with Sugarloaf Mountain and Corcovado.

Please note: the Coopavel Show Rural is usually held in the first or second week of February. Please contact us to confirm the departure date for this tour.

Sample Itinerary

Day 1

Begin the Brazil Agriculture tour when you arrive at the Foz do Iguaçu airport. Greet your guide and transfer to your hotel in Foz do Iguaçu near the spectacular Iguassu Falls. These waterfalls straddle the border between Argentina and Brazil and are one of the largest waterfalls on earth. Enjoy a free afternoon exploring the area, and then feast on a Brazilian dinner (included) after a relaxing swim in the pool.

Day 2

Enjoy a full-day excursion to the Iguassu Falls, seeing this natural wonder from both the Argentine and Brazilian sides. Cross into Argentina for a walk above the falls, then take a boat ride to see them up close and feel the spray of the Cascades. Afterward, return to the Brazil side and walk along platforms to get a stunning view of the mighty Devil's Throat, the largest of the waterfalls at Iguassu. Spend the day wandering through the forests in the Brazilian or Argentine sides of the falls. Home to several species of butterflies, birds and other wildlife, the national parks offer several pleasant walking trails from which to study them. Return to Foz do Iguaçu in the evening.

Day 3

Head to Cascavel this morning, a hub of Brazil’s most efficient farming cooperatives. Famous for hosting the annual Coopaval Show Rural fair, it draws small-town subsistence farmers and large cooperatives alike. Crowds of farmers flock to the fair to learn about novel farming technologies. Spend the day absorbing new knowledge and return to Cascavel or nearby Toledo for the night.

Day 4

Travel to the soybean region of Paraná. Stop at the rail station of Ferropar where soybeans and other agricultural products are shipped to the Port of Paranaguá. Learn how they are cultivated and then continue to Guarapuava, a popular area for soybean plantations. Spend the night here on a farm and enjoy the rustic atmosphere of the countryside.

Day 5

Continue seeing the rest of the rural region on Day 5. Travel through rolling landscapes of farmlands, subtropical forests and Araucária trees before arriving in Curitiba, named the best-organized city in South America. The capital of the state of Paraná, Curitiba has grown tenfold in the past twenty years, innovatively managing its substantial growth. The city is a melting pot of cultures, including Dutch, Polish, Arab, German, Ukrainian, Italian and Japanese influences. After checking into the Curitiba Hotel, sample this multicultural mix through the cuisine, and enjoy a delicious dinner which is included in the tour.

Day 6

Today, enjoy a tour of Curitiba’s highlights including the Glass Opera House and verdant Botanical Gardens. Head down to the coast for a scenic stroll along the historic promenade of the Port of Paranaguá. Fill up on a tasty lunch and then board the historic railway train as it winds its way up to 1,200m above sea level through the Atlantic Rainforest Mountains before returning to Curitiba. Then relax at your hotel after an active day seeing the sights.

Day 7

Fly to São Paulo and explore the largest city in Brazil. Take a guided tour of this colorful tourist destination including landmarks like the Paulista Avenue, Patio do Colégio, the Sé Cathedral, Liberdade Japanese district and the financial district.

Day 8

Awake to a new day and board a plane to the “Marvelous City", Rio de Janeiro. Transfer to your hotel on Copacabana beach. Take advantage of a few spare hours to walk along the waterfront, do some shopping, swim at the beach or relax at the rooftop pool. Meet up with some travel companions to drink a toast to a wonderful first day in Rio at a rodizio, a Brazilian barbecue (included).

Day 9

The panoramic view from the top of the Sugarloaf Mountain is the highlight of today's sightseeing tour. Board a cable car to reach the summit and be rewarded with a 360º view of golden beaches, green forests and the thriving metropolis of Rio de Janeiro, a sight that has earned it the title of the world's most beautiful city.

Continue with a tour of Rio's historical past. Learn how Portugal's prince broke all family ties and declared himself Emperor of Brazil. Everything slows down in the afternoon heat and the Cariocas, as the locals call themselves, head for the beach. Feel free to join them and take a cool dip after a day of seeing the sights.

Day 10

Finish your Brazil Agriculture Tour with a visit to Corcovado Mountain, where the Statue of Christ the Redeemer keeps an eye on Rio from an elevation of 710m. Board the trenzinho cogwheel railway up to the top of Corcovado Mountain for a bird's eye view of the center of the city. This evening, depart for home or your onward journey.
